Abstract
A steering system for an articulated vehicle having a pair of double acting steering cylinders and power steering means consisting of a pump and a hydrostatic steering unit to which the steering wheel of the vehicle is interconnected. Control means are disposed between the power steering means and the double acting cylinders for causing fluid to be directed from the power steering means to both of the first and second cylinders during rotation of the steering wheel at a first steering ratio when the pump is in operation, and at a second higher steering ratio when the pump is not in operation to permit manual steering of the vehicle.
